[Explanation] Small bridges and flowing water, old gray tile houses, and grandma with a basket on their backs, every house here is a check-in place, it is hard to imagine that this is the famous "mud village" in the past.

Recently, a reporter from China News Agency saw in Fuba Village, Changba Town, Kang County, Longnan City, Gansu Province, that the old warehouses were turned into cafes, and the old idle houses were turned into guest houses and inns. The adobe walls were painted on. Colored paintings, parking areas and guide signs are clearly visible, and the ancient roads walking through the village are full of local memories.

  [Explanation] Walking into a cafe in the village, the vases made of straw and feathers and the lights made of ropes attracted many visitors to stop and take pictures.

Li Jianqiang, the relevant person in charge, told reporters that the cafe was renovated from the old houses in the village, and the area where guests drink coffee was renovated from the old granary. During the renovation, while the main structure remained unchanged, modern and fashionable features were added. elements, while retaining the local feeling and Gansu flavor.

  [Explanation] Feng Caixia, the village cadre in the village, said that before 2014, Fuba Village had imperfect infrastructure and a "dirty and poor living environment". It was a famous "mud village" in the local area. The construction is deeply integrated with rural tourism and characteristic homestays, and infrastructure construction projects such as power grid transformation have been fully implemented to improve the living environment.

  The poverty incidence rate of the masses in (the village) in 2013 was 53.7%, and the whole village was lifted out of poverty in 2018, but as of last year, our per capita (annual) income was also above 12,300 yuan, which can be said to far exceed the poverty line.   [Explanation] In addition to cafes, the local area also excavates historical sites, folk culture, local customs, strengthens the protection of the original appearance of the countryside, ancient dwellings, and ancient workshops, and restores the old educated youth courtyard, wine workshop, tofu workshop and other places to achieve "one "One product for every household", "One scene for one place", "One scene for one rhyme".
